Immerse yourself in the tranquility of Kaashi, a hidden paradise nestled in the Shaviyani Atoll of the Maldives. This video captures the soothing embrace of nature with rustic wooden pathways shaded by lush green foliage, swaying palm-fronds, and the warm golden light of a peaceful morning. The natural textures and organic architecture create an intimate escape from the rush of everyday life, perfect for travelers seeking calm, soulful moments close to the pristine tropical sea. Experience the soul-soothing sounds of rustling leaves and gentle ocean breezes as you visualize your dream getaway on this dreamlike island retreat.

The nearest airport is Velana International Airport (MLE) in Malé, approximately a 40-minute domestic flight followed by a boat transfer to Shaviyani Atoll.
